Let's rewind the clock to an era when life was simpler, and natural remedies were the cornerstone of health. In the shadows of our fast-paced world, reflexology quietly thrived in the practices of ancient civilizations. Think Chinese wisdom, Egyptian insight, and Native American traditions. These cultures saw a profound link between specific points on the feet and hands and the body's inner workings.

Picture ancient China, where practitioners noticed that certain foot points held the key to unlocking energy flow throughout the body. The Egyptians, on the other hand, left behind hieroglyphs hinting at the therapeutic potential of foot massages. Even Native American tribes had a knack for weaving foot and hand manipulation into their rituals, seeking equilibrium and healing. These cultures had an innate understanding that the feet and hands held secrets to holistic well-being, shaping the essence of reflexology.

Zoom ahead to the 20th century, where the ancient whispers transformed into a full-fledged practice, thanks to the pioneering spirit of Eunice Ingham. The trailblazer often dubbed the "mother of reflexology" gave the practice its much-needed modern makeover.

Ingham's game-changing contribution? Mapping out reflexology zones on the feet. Taking inspiration from the ancients, she meticulously connected dots between specific foot areas and various organs and systems within. Through years of meticulous observation and hands-on experimentation, she introduced the concept of applying pressure to these zones to alleviate pain, boost circulation, and restore equilibrium.
